The Essentials of Metal Finishing - Typically, the finishing of metal is desirable for aesthetics or for clean-room usage. It really is one of the most popular processes simply because of its use in intensifying the natural attractiveness of the item, for example, motor bike parts, kitchenware or motor vehicle parts. In addition, lots of clean-rooms really need a shiny finish so to lessen the porosity of the components which can result in dust to gather and contaminate. An illustration of this usage would be in vacuum chambers.

There exist a great number of ways to finish metals, and let us have a look at a number of the methods involved. Various metals may be polished electromechanically, using chemicals, by hand, or with special buffing machines. A buffing compound or paste is regularly employed, which will incorporate ch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Finishing stainless steel, due to its inferior thermal conductivity, comparatively high viscidity, and hardness is amongst the time intensive. Opposite of that scenario, things composed of non-ferrous metals are definitely more receptive to finishing, simply because these need the lower amount of processes.

Finishing buffs covered with paste can be enormously impacted by specific forces on the p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face could be raised to a specific range, though exceeding the optimum level of pressure not just minimizes the quality of the procedure, but additionally can worsen efficiency, can create wear to the component, and furthermore a significant heating of the objects being worked on, generated by friction. When you are working on thinner items, it will be elevated heat (and a corresponding pliability of the material) which can cause elements to twist, flex, or bend. On the whole, it will take an educated polisher to look at all of these points to equally avoid harm to the piece and to perform successfully. To help you substantially increase the quality of the resulting surface area, the buffing action should really be done with considerably less vigour and not as much pressure so as to consequently produce a surface that is free of scratches or marks as a consequence of the finishing process, thereby ar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
